Software for embedded systems pdf

Performance analysis the slides contain material from the embedded. Coming together of embedded systems and the internet which make possible. Embedded systems are a combination of hardware and software as well as other components that we bring together inti products. Embedded software is a piece of software that is embedded in hardware or nonpc devices. Understand the scientific principles and concepts behind embedded systems, and 2. With the continuing shift from hardware to software, embedded systems are increasingly dominated by embedded software. It is written specifically for the particular hardware that it runs on and usually has processing and memory. The convergence of alm with systems engineering robert wirthlin, phd 2018 spring meeting, plm center of excellence, purdue university. These types of embedded systems design with a single or 16 or 32 bit microcontroller, riscs or dsps. Written by experts with a solutions focus, this encyclopedic. This book will teach you how to use c in any embedded system. Programming embedded systems steps knowledge services. Embedded system study materials, important questions list, embedded system syllabus, embedded system lecture notes can be download in pdf format.

Their huge numbers and new complexity call for a new design approach, one. Since software has an enormous impact on power consumption in an embedded system, this book urges software engineers to manage heat effectively by understanding, categorizing and developing new ways to. Obtain handson experience in programming embedded systems. Moreover, based on the information, we derive an attack taxonomy for embedded systems. Welcome to the introduction to embedded systems software and development environments. Written by experts with a solutions focus, this encyclopedic reference gives you an indispensable aid to tackling the daytoday problems when using software engineering methods to develop your embedded systems. Understand how to develop software for the lab platform. Compare the best free open source windows embedded systems software at sourceforge. It covers trends and challenges, introduces the design and use of.

Unlike software designed for generalpurpose computers, embedded software cannot usually be run on other embedded systems without significant modification. Introduction the stateoftheart in software engineering for embedded systems is far behind other application areas. Since thermal management is a key bottleneck in embedded systems design, this book focuses on root cause of heat in embedded systems. Embedded systems, field devices, component based software development 1. This course is focused on giving you real world coding experience and hands on project work with arm. Examples of embedded software include avionics, consumer electronics, motors, automobile safety systems, and robotics. Innovation in technology along with mounting smart grid initiatives is likely to fuel. This expert guide gives you the techniques and technologies in software engineering to optimally design and implement your embedded system.

In the current improving technologies studying of embedded system is required to understand the electronic circuits. An embedded system is one that has computer hardware with software embedded in it as one of its important components. Emergence of several integrated software environments which simplified the development of the applications. Software engineering for embedded systems book pdf download. Even if you already know how to write embedded software. Introduction to embedded systems by shibu kv gives a balanced protection of all the concepts and helps in giving a wise oriented technique. Embedded software an overview sciencedirect topics.

Embedded systems represents an integration of laptop hardware, software program along with programming concepts for creating specificgoal laptop system designed to perform one or a few devoted options. Embedded systems represents an integration of laptop hardware, software program along with programming concepts for creating specificgoal laptop system designed to perform one or a few. In todays world, embedded systems are everywhere homes, offices, cars, factories, hospitals, plans and consumer electronics. Here we are providing embedded systems textbook by raj kamal pdf free download. These types of embedded systems have both hardware and software complexities. Embedded system study materials, important questions list, embedded system syllabus, embedded system lecture notes can. Download introduction to embedded systems pdf ebook. For embedded systems software development tools, libraries are very important and convenient. An embedded system can be thought of as a computer hardware system having software embedded in it. Methods, practical techniques, and applications, second edition provides the techniques and technologies in software engineering to optimally design and. An embedded system is a microcontroller or microprocessor based system which is designed to perform a specific task. To possess a thorough knowledge of embedded systems and grasp its intricacies, then embedded systems authored by raj kamal is the apt book to pick up. An embedded system can be an independent system or it can be a part of a. Covers the significant embedded computing technologieshighlighting their applications in wireless communication and computing power an embedded system is a computer system.

An embedded system is a microcontroller or microprocessor based system which is. Raj kamal ebook pdf this book, similarly relevant for a cse or ece course, gives a broad record of embedded systems, keeping an adjusted scope of equipment. By the end of the course, you should be able to understand the big ideas in embedded systems obtain direct handson experience on both hardware and software elements commonly used in embedded system design. An embedded system is one kind of a computer system mainly designed to perform several tasks like to access, process, store and also control the data in various electronicsbased systems. Uniti overview of embedded systems embedded system. Understand what interviewers look for when you apply for an embedded systems job making embedded systems is the book for a c programmer who wants to enter the fun and lucrative world of embedded.

Introduction to embedded systems software and development. Embedded system market size is expected to exceed usd 258. Software engineering for embedded systems book pdf. Embedded software is computer software, written to control machines or devices that are not typically thought of as computers, commonly known as embedded systems. An embedded system can be an independent system or it can be a part of a large system. Automotive embedded software applications are quite different than typical embedded software applications that we find on smart devices such as phones, gadgets etc. Introduction to embedded system basics and applications. Tech student with free of cost and it can download. Free, secure and fast windows embedded systems software downloads from the largest open source applications and software directory. This book introduces a modern approach to embedded system design, presenting software design and hardware design in a unified manner. Performance analysis the slides contain material from the embedded system design book and lecture of peter marwedel and from the hard realtime computing systems book of giorgio buttazzo. Pdf ee6602 embedded system es books, lecture notes. An embedded system is a computer that has been built to solve only a few very.

1174 1444 120 629 543 1006 606 1396 212 920 13 850 1255 115 1314 672 1227 1457 640 28 1320 276 646 453 994 1011 316 1235 471 1157 1211 1396 290 923 1235 297 76 529 496 410 219